WebAug 7, 2024 · Overview of Fresh Pineapple Market in Russia In 2024, ... Why does pineapple burn my tongue? Because the bromelain dissolves the protective mucous that coats your tongue and the roof of your mouth, the acidity of the pineapple is particularly irritating. It’s the one-two punch of bromelain and acid that really drives the stinging …
